¿Cómo puedo habilitar?citas al estilo de Interneten Outlook Web Access? he encontradovarios guíasencómohabilítelo en Outlook, pero ni uno solo en Outlook Web Access. Estamos ejecutando la versión 8.1.
No puedo acceder al servidor usando Exchange/IMAP externamente. Esto me está generando problemas importantes ahora, ya que tengo que dedicar mucho tiempo a editar correos electrónicos largos antes de enviar respuestas.
Respuesta1
No tuno puedohacer cotizaciones por correo electrónico en OWA. Dicho esto, puedes usar Firefox con el¡Es todo texto!complemento para abrir el texto en un editor de texto y luego agregar el prefijo de cita allí. DeArreglar el estilo de cotización de Outlook:
En OWA, elija responder a un mensaje. Aparece un texto de mensaje horriblemente citado.
Utilice It's All Text o alguna otra herramienta similar para abrir el texto del mensaje en un editor razonablemente inteligente.
Filtre el texto completo del mensaje a través de este script. Por ejemplo, en Vim escriba
:%!path-to-script.rb
, después de hacer que el script sea ejecutable, por supuesto.Reemplace el texto del mensaje original con la salida del filtro. Si usa Es todo texto, simplemente escriba
:wq
.¡Presto! Mensaje correctamente citado. Quizás tengas que mover tu firma.
Así es como se usa, ahora aquí está el script:
#!/usr/bin/env ruby # Fix outlook quoting. Inspired by perl original by Kevin D. Clark. # This program is meant to be used as a text filter. It reads a plaintext # outlook-formatted email and fixes the quoting to the "internet style", # so that:: # # -----Original Message----- # [from-header]: Blah blah # [timestamp-header]: day month etc # [...] # # message text # # or:: # # ___________________________ # [from-header]: Blah blah # [timestamp-header]: day month etc # [...] # # message text # # becomes:: # # On day month etc, Blah blah wrote: # > message text # # It's not meant to alter the contents of other peoples' messages, just to # filter the topmost message so that when you start replying, you get a nice # basis to start from. require 'date' require 'pp' message = ARGF.read # split into two parts at the first reply delimiter # match group so leaves the delim in the array, # this gets stripped away in the FieldRegex if's else clause msgparts = message.split(/(---*[\w\s]+---*|______*)/) # first bit is what we've written so far mymsg = msgparts.slice!(0) # rest is the quoted message theirmsg = msgparts.join # this regex separates message header field name from field content FieldRegex = /^\s*(.+?):\s*(.+)$/ from = nil date = nil theirbody = [] theirmsg.lines do |line| if !from || !date if FieldRegex =~ line parts = line.scan(FieldRegex) if !from from = parts.first.last elsif !date begin DateTime.parse(parts.first.last) date = parts.first.last rescue ArgumentError # not a parseable date.. let's just fail date = " " end end else # ignore non-field, this strips extra message delims for example end else theirbody << line.gsub(/^/, "> ").gsub(/> >/, ">>") end end puts mymsg puts "On #{date}, #{from} wrote:\n" puts theirbody.join("")
Respuesta2
Esto es lo que hice...
Copie la parte del mensaje que desea citar, desplácese hacia arriba hasta su respuesta y luego haga clic en el botón "citar" (debajo de la barra de herramientas "mensaje"), luego péguelo.
El mensaje pegado aparece con el estilo predeterminado de una barra gris a la izquierda; Para insertar respuestas dentro del texto citado, simplemente coloque el cursor allí y presione Enter o Return varias veces para salir de la cita e ingresar sus respuestas en línea:
Esto está en Outlook Web App alojado en outlook.office365.com; No estoy seguro de cómo comprobar qué versión, pero creo que es una versión actual en el momento de escribir este artículo (agosto de 2023). Espero que sea útil. Ojalá estuviera más integrado, pero al menos no es demasiado difícil y no requiere ningún software ni complementos adicionales.